Abstract: Golf ball having CoR of at least 0.810, specific gravity SGB of less than 1.00 g/cc, and initial velocity of at least 250 ft/s and comprising a first layer L1, a second layer L2 surrounding L1, and a third layer L3 surrounding L2. L1 is formed from at least one highly neutralized polymer and has first specific gravity SG1; L2 is formed from at least one partially neutralized polymer and has second specific gravity SG2; and L3 is formed from at least one of a thermoset or thermoplastic composition and has third specific gravity SG3. At least two of SG1, SG2, and SG3 is less than 1.13 g/cc. SG1 may be less than 1.13 g/cc, or less than 1.0 g/cc. The thermoset or thermoplastic composition may comprise polyurethane(s), polyurea(s), polyurethane(s)/polyurea(s) hybrids, and/or ionomers such as at least partially neutralized polymers and/or HNPs.

Abstract: A golf ball includes a single core having an outer surface and a geometric center. The core is formed from a substantially homogenous rubber composition. An inner cover layer is disposed about the core, the inner cover including a high-acid ionomer and having a material hardness of about 66 to 75 Shore D. The high-acid ionomer has an acid content of about 16% or greater. An outer cover layer is disposed about the inner cover layer, the outer cover including a polyurethane and having a material hardness of about 38 Shore D to about 56 Shore D. The core surface hardness is from 0 Shore C to 15 Shore C lower than the geometric center hardness to define a hardness gradient.

Abstract: A multi-piece golf ball comprising at least one component made of a polybutadiene rubber/ionomer resin blend is provided. The ball preferably contains a dual-core comprising an inner core and surrounding outer core layer. Preferably, the polybutadiene rubber/ionomer resin blend is used to form the outer core layer. Preferably, the outer surface hardness of the outer core layer is greater than the outer surface hardness of the inner core. The resulting ball has high resiliency and good impact durability.
